Sustainable power generation Photovoltaic panel, or photovoltaics (PV), capture the sun's energy and convert it into electricity to make use of in your house. Mounting photovoltaic panels lets you make use of cost-free, renewable, tidy electricity to power your appliances. You can sell additional electrical power to the grid or store it for later use.
East or west facing roofs still work, but we do not advise mounting photovoltaic panels on a north dealing with roof covering. A system facing east or west tends to navigate 15-20% much less energy than one dealing with directly southern. Neighboring buildings, trees or chimneys could color your roofing and have an unfavorable influence on the performance of your system.
Solar panels on residences are taken into consideration 'permitted growth' and don't usually require preparing consent. But there are exemptions so it's ideal to consult your local preparation workplace for assistance. There might be added restrictions if you live in a: listed structure conservation location national park If you're preparing to install a solar panel system in your home, you have to register it with your Distribution Network Operator (DNO).

It is necessary that the panels don't disrupt the roofing covering to keep it watertight. Consequently, several systems are weighted down instead of repaired with the roofing covering. If you have a system that's weighted down, the roof needs to be strong enough to handle the included weight.

Yes, you can install panels on an outhouse. If the building does not have its own power supply already after that you should factor this in when looking at the complete cost of the system.
Solar electrical energy is a clean, renewable resource source. A normal home photovoltaic panel system could conserve around one tonne of carbon each year, depending on where you reside in the UK. That's the matching of driving 3,600 miles, or from London to Bristol 30 times. Export the electrical power you can not use yourself and obtain paid for it.

This only relates to England, Scotland and Wales. If you stay in North Ireland, talk with your power vendor to see if they offer an export tariff. Instead of sending excess power to the grid, a solar diverter switch can power the immersion heater in your warm water tank, saving warm water for you to utilize later.
Solar go to this website panels on their own offer reduced power costs and tidy energy. However they're at their best when incorporated with various other sustainable technologies. Rather than exporting excess power, you might keep it for later usage. Battery storage space lets you conserve your solar power to make use of when your panels aren't creating energy.

For each unit of electrical energy saved in a battery and used at night, it will save you around 14p. Battery storage space often tends to set you back about 5,000 to 8,000. A heatpump is a reduced carbon furnace that's powered by electrical energy. Making use of a photovoltaic panel system to power the heatpump, you can check here you can lower both your electrical power and your home heating expenses.
